D. H. Mao H. G. Robinson D. U. Bartholomew C. R. Helms 《Journal of Electronic Materials》1997,26(6):678-682
Simulations of current-voltage characteristics of ion-implanted n-on-p photodiodes have been performed using SemiCad Device.
In order to accurately simulate this device structure, several modifications to the simulator were implemented. These include
the modified carrier statistics to account for the nonparabolic band structure of HgCdTe, the correct physics parameters for
Shockley-Read-Hall, optical, and Auger recombination, and the Burstein-Moss shift for optical absorption important for heavily
doped n-type HgCdTe. With these and other improvements, SemiCad Device is calibrated with the measured ideal dark current
of an ion implanted diode and is used to simulate a source of non-ideal dark current from surface-charge induced band-to-band
tunneling. 相似文献

Plasmonic nanocrystals have been attracting a lot of attention both for fundamental studies and different applications, from sensing to imaging and optoelectronic devices. Transparent conductive oxides represent an interesting class of plasmonic materials in addition to metals and vacancy-doped semiconductor quantum dots. Herein, we report a rational synthetic strategy of high-quality colloidal aluminum-doped zinc oxide nanocrystals. The presence of substitutional aluminum in the zinc oxide lattice accompanied by the generation of free electrons is proved for the first time by tunable surface plasmon absorption in the infrared region both in solution and in thin films. 相似文献

Rincon-Gonzalez L Warren JP Meller DM Tillery SH 《IEEE transactions on neural systems and rehabilitation engineering》2011,19(5):490-500
Somatosensation is divided into multiple discrete modalities that we think of separably: e.g., tactile, proprioceptive, and temperature sensation. However, in processes such as haptics,those modalities all interact. If one intended to artificially generate a sensation that could be used for stereognosis, for example, it would be crucial to understand these interactions. We are presently examining the relationship between tactile and proprioceptive modalities in this context. In this overview of some of our recent work, we show that signals that would normally be attributed to two of these systems separately, tactile contact and self-movement, interact both perceptually and physiologically in ways that complicate the understanding of haptic processing. In the first study described here, we show that a tactile illusion on the fingertips, the cutaneous rabbit effect, can be abolished by changing the posture of the fingers. We then discuss activity in primary somatosensory cortical neurons illustrating the interrelationship of tactile and postural signals. In this study, we used a robot-enhanced virtual environment to show that many neurons in primary somatosensory cortex with cutaneous receptive fields encode elements both of tactile contact and self-motion. We then show the results of studies examining the structure of the process which extracts the spatial location of the hand from proprioceptive signals. The structure of the spatial errors in these maps indicates that the proprioceptive-spatial map is stable but individually constructed.These seemingly disparate studies lead us to suggest that tactile sensation is encoded in a 2-D map, but one which undergoes continual dynamic modification by an underlying proprioceptive map. Understanding how the disparate signals that comprise the somatosensory system are processed to produce sensation is an important step in realizing the kind of seamless integration aspired to in neuroprosthetics. 相似文献

Treating the marital dyad as the unit of analysis, this study examined the within-couple patterning of 272 dual-earner spouses' provider role attitudes and their longitudinal associations with marital satisfaction, role overload, and the division of housework. Based on the congruence of husbands' and wives' provider role attitudes, couples were classified into one of four types: (a) main-secondary, (b) coprovider, (c) ambivalent coprovider, and (d) mismatched couples. Nearly half of all spouses differed in their attitudes about breadwinning. A series of mixed model ANCOVAs revealed significant between- and within-couple differences in human capital characteristics, spouses' perceptions of marital satisfaction and role overload, and the division of housework across 3 years of measurement. Coprovider couples reported higher levels of marital satisfaction and a more equitable division of housework than the other couple groups. Wives in the ambivalent coprovider couples' group reported higher levels of role overload than their husbands to a greater extent than was found in the other couple groups. As the first study to adopt a dyadic approach that considers the meanings that both spouses in dual-earner couples ascribe to paid employment, these findings advance understanding of how dual-earner spouses' provider role attitudes serve as contexts for marital quality, behavior, and role-related stress. We have identified and characterized a human beta (CC) chemokine, designated HCC-4, that is most closely related to HCC-1 and which demonstrates chemotactic activity for monocytes. Northern analysis of multiple tissue blots and of activated monocytes mRNA shows expression of a 500-bp mRNA. A 1,500-bp mRNA was highly expressed in monocytes activated 12 hours in the presence of interleukin-10 (IL-10) but was absent in monocytes activated for only 1 hour regardless of the presence or absence of IL-10. The upregulation of expression in the presence of IL-10 is in contrast to the downregulatory effects of IL-10 on expression of most other chemokines. Recombinant HCC-4 demonstrated chemotactic activity for human monocytes and THP-1 monocyte cells but not for resting lymphocytes or neutrophils. HCC-4 also induced a Ca2+ flux in THP-1 cells that was desensitized by prior exposure to RANTES. Taken together, these data indicate that HCC-4 is a novel chemokine whose expression is uniquely upregulated by IL-10. 相似文献

The performance of a demonstrator for the distribution of 32 digital uncompressed TV channels using HDWDM has been examined. For the transmission 8 optical wavelengths have been used spaced by 2 nm in the 1529-1543 nm range carrying a data rate of 8×622 Mbt/s. Without optical amplifier a splitting factor of 16 has been obtained for the PON with low crosstalk and polarization sensitivities. The demonstrator is the distributive part of a combined demonstrator including broad- and narrowband interactive services 相似文献

In the treatment of Menière's disease, surgical procedures are available when conservative measures have failed. The most distressing symptom of vertigo can frequently be arrested, tinnitus reduced and hearing improved. Sudden deafness due to round window rupture is treatable. The most important disorder with labyrinthe symptoms is the acoustic neuroma, the smaller ones of which can be operated on by otologists in collaboration with neurosurgeons using the transtemporal or translabyrinthine approach with preservation of the facial nerve. 相似文献

Jianjun Guo Waisiu Law Helms W.J. Allstot D.J. 《IEEE transactions on instrumentation and measurement》2004,53(6):1485-1492
The original digital calibration approach for 1 b/stage and 1.5 b/stage pipeline analog-digital converters produces missing or nonmonotonic digital codes with the device and circuit impairments typical of modern deep submicrometer CMOS technologies. Two digital calibration algorithms are introduced to improve pipeline performance when using low-voltage low-gain nonlinear operational amplifiers and high random dc offset voltage comparators. The first technique computes calibration coefficients for each stage at actual transition points of the residue characteristic to assure converter monotonicity in the presence of random comparator offset voltages. The second augments a conventional pipelined architecture with an input-dependent level-shifting stage and additional digital calibration circuitry to achieve high differential and integral linearity with low-gain nonlinear operational amplifiers. 相似文献
